Output d683b762ed5c3d8f5e4eccaa51e1d5fed03e4e2e94e2bc7529ffc172e36bfca7:0

value
5009890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e345d240fe2747b0ceb98e5b9c929f8cd5c74a OP_EQUALVERIFY OP_CHECKSIG
address
1MgfyYM5XoB3RLxnvW4vyZavrFNapTMQWk
transaction
d683b762ed5c3d8f5e4eccaa51e1d5fed03e4e2e94e2bc7529ffc172e36bfca7
confirmations
420891
spent
true